Keystone Jacks Explained: Mix and Match Your Ports
Keystone jacks are the small, interchangeable modules that snap into the holes of your wall plate. This standard format is the secret to a professional-looking installation, as it allows you to combine an Ethernet port, a coax connector, and an HDMI coupler on a single faceplate. You are no longer limited to fixed, manufacturer-specific outlets.
To build a custom setup, you simply select the plate with the number of “ports” (the holes) you need and purchase the corresponding jacks. These jacks snap in from the back or front depending on the manufacturer’s design. The standardization means you can swap out a phone jack for an Ethernet jack later without replacing the entire plate.
Understanding this modularity is critical to future-proofing any space. As connectivity needs change, you only swap the cheap, internal jack rather than performing invasive wall work. Always look for “keystone compatible” labeling to ensure your jacks will fit your chosen wall plate perfectly.
Planning Your Runs Before You Cut Any Holes
Before taking a saw to your wall, you must map out the cable route. Verify that the path between the two points is clear of studs, electrical wires, and plumbing lines. Use a stud finder and a borescope if possible, as drilling blindly into a wall in a tiny home or RV can lead to catastrophic, irreversible damage.
Consider the “bend radius” of your cables during the planning phase. HDMI and fiber optic cables are particularly sensitive to tight bends and can lose performance if forced through an inadequate path. Ensure that your wall plate location allows for a smooth, gentle transition for the cables coming out of the wall.
Also, keep low-voltage cables (data, speaker) at least six inches away from high-voltage electrical lines. Running these cables side-by-side inside a wall can introduce electromagnetic interference, causing flickering screens or slow internet speeds. Careful planning ensures that your finished system works exactly as intended on the first try.
Installing Plates with a Low-Voltage Bracket
Low-voltage brackets are the unsung heroes of interior cable routing. Unlike high-voltage electrical boxes that are bulky and rigid, these brackets are essentially open-backed frames that secure the wall plate to the drywall without needing a stud. They provide a sturdy mounting point that is essential for a clean, professional finish.
Installation is straightforward: trace the bracket onto the wall, cut the hole, insert the bracket, and tighten the mounting wings. This pulls the bracket flush against the back of the drywall, creating a rigid anchor for the wall plate. Once secured, your cable plate will not wobble or sink into the wall when you plug in a heavy cable.
Never try to screw a wall plate directly into drywall, as it will inevitably pull out over time. Using a low-voltage bracket is a small, inexpensive step that dramatically improves the structural integrity of your setup. It is the defining line between a DIY project that feels temporary and one that feels like a permanent, built-in feature.
Common Mistakes When Routing Interior Cables
One of the most frequent errors is overtightening the screws on the wall plate. While it might feel secure, putting too much pressure on the plastic can lead to cracking or warping over time. Aim for a “snug but not forced” fit to ensure the plate sits flat against the wall without distorting.
Another major oversight is neglecting to label your cables behind the wall. Once the plates are installed, it is nearly impossible to identify which cable goes to which port. Use simple, wrap-around wire labels at both ends of every cable before you feed them through the wall to save yourself massive headaches during future troubleshooting.
Finally, avoid leaving excess “service loops” dangling inside the wall cavity if they interfere with the wall plate’s fit. While it is good practice to have a bit of slack for maintenance, coiled, tangled cables can exert pressure on the back of the keystone jacks. Keep the wiring behind the plate as organized as the wiring in front of it to ensure maximum longevity.
